Microsoft and Accenture use blockchain tech to build a digital ID network. It will help give legal identification to 1.1 billion people without official documents. The platform will use blockchain to connect with record-keeping systems at commercial and public organizations. People will be able to access their personal information from wherever they are in the world. The project is part of a broader United Nations-supported initiative to help people who don’t have official documents and can’t access education, healthcare, and other services.”]
